Mission No. Eleven – September 8, 1944
Target: Ludwigshaven – Synthetic Oil & Chemical Plant
Bomb Load: 6-1000# G.P.
Gas Load: 2700 gallons
Briefing: 0530
Plane: R4890 – Queen O’Hearts
Position: #3, #1 Element, Lead Sqdn., 41st “A” Gp.
T.O.: 0753 Land: 1513 Time: 7 hours, 20 minutes
Left Base: 0857 @ 14000′
Bombs Away: 1152; 27300′; -40 degrees C.
Distance: 1192 SM
Remarks: Long flight. Mostly over occupied territory. On oxygen for six hours. First real cold mission. We all had trouble keeping warm. Had trouble getting thru clouds on way in. Intense flak over target. Number of small holes but no serious damage. Group lost five planes. More trouble with clouds on way back. Saw parts of Paris and Eiffel Tower thru break in clouds.
[This was the 379th Bomb Group’s 199th mission.]
